Eli Lilly Stock Forecast
Wall Street analysts rate Eli Lilly a "Strong Buy" with an average 12-month price target of $1,134, about 7% above its current price. Targets range from $700 on the low end to $1,500 at the high. The bullish case rests on continued GLP-1 drug demand — Mounjaro and Zepbound generated over $40 billion combined in 2025. Lilly's own 2026 guidance calls for $80–83 billion in revenue and $33.50–$35 in non-GAAP EPS. The expected launch of an oral GLP-1 pill, orforglipron, could further widen its addressable market. Rising competition from Novo Nordisk and compounded alternatives remains a risk.

Timeline of Eli Lilly Funding
1876
Company Founded
Colonel Eli Lilly, a pharmacist and Civil War veteran, started Eli Lilly and Company in Indianapolis with $1,400 in capital.
1937
Lilly Endowment Established
The Lilly family created the Lilly Endowment, a charitable foundation funded by company shares. It remains Eli Lilly's single largest shareholder today at ~10% ownership.
1952
IPO — Listed on NYSE
Eli Lilly offered its first public shares on the New York Stock Exchange, opening the company to institutional and retail investors for the first time.
1986–1997
Four Stock Splits (2-for-1 each)
The company executed 2-for-1 stock splits in 1986, 1989, 1995, and 1997 — effectively multiplying each original share into 16 shares over this period.
2020–2024
$27B+ Manufacturing Investment
Lilly committed over $27 billion to new U.S. manufacturing sites and facility expansions, including a $3 billion Wisconsin plant, to meet surging GLP-1 drug demand.
November 2025
$1 Trillion Market Cap
Eli Lilly became the first healthcare company to reach a $1 trillion market capitalization, driven by blockbuster Mounjaro and Zepbound sales.
